She Persisted: Rosalind Franklin
Rosalind Franklin loved science, but that wasn't a field many women were included in when she was young. Still, she persisted in pursuing her dreams, and conducted vital research on both coal and viruses. She also played a key role in the discovery of the double helix structure of DNA, though her male colleagues took credit for her work. Learn about the amazing life of Rosalind Franklin and how she persisted.
